Hi, to become an Architect, with legal registration number allotted from Council of Architecture, New Delhi, a candidate has to posses a degree in Architecture (B.Arch).

This option is not generally available to pursue architecture after civil engineering, as it usually requires a Bachelor's degree in architecture as the eligibility criteria.
